Yohji Yamamoto at the V&A Photography Nick Knight Art Direction Peter Saville

Summing up a 40 year career in just 80 garments? Sounds a bit impossible, especially when the career in question happens to be one of the most prolific in modern fashion history.  It’s only fitting then that the challenge would be embraced by one of the most celebrated fashion exhibitors in the world. This March, London’s famed Victoria & Albert Museum opens its doors for the most highly anticipated retrospective of the year: an exhibition dedicated to the work of a groundbreaking Japanese fashion master.  No other modern designer has been quite so intriguing or has made quite so significantly a mark on modern fashion. Take an adorable gang of pooches, add a dose of Lady Gaga’s infamous dramatic style and what to you get? A highly viral, slightly controversial and totally addictive photo series that’s been making headlines around the world. The “Doggie Gaga Project”, the ultimate symbol of contemporary pop culture, is the brainchild of Californian photographer Jesse Freidin.
